Got $1,000? 2 Magnificent Artificial Intelligence (AI) Stocks Down 15% or More From Their Highs to Buy Hand Over Fist
Broadcom and Alphabet make for two great AI investments.
The market is giving investors a few gifts right now. There are several companies whose shares are on sale, and investors should be taking advantage of these deals while they are available. Two stocks down significantly from their all-time highs that look like solid buys are Alphabet(NASDAQ: GOOG)(NASDAQ: GOOGL) and Broadcom(NASDAQ: AVGO). Alphabet is down more than 15% while Broadcom is down about 20%.
I don't expect these levels to last for long, as each has several growth catalysts that can push them to new all-time highs before 2026 is over.
